The Overall Health Score in 73645, Erick, Oklahoma is 6 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

68.43 percent of the population in 73645 drive to work alone. 0.00 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 71.46 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 6.06 percent of the residents in 73645 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 1.52 members with about 2.00 cars available per household.

An estimate of 83.44 percent of the residents in 73645 has some form of health insurance. 43.35 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 53.30 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 73645 would have to travel an average of 28.29 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Great Plains Regional Medical Center . In a 20-mile radius, there are 6 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 73645, Erick, Oklahoma.

As of , an estimate of 1,105 residents live in 73645 with a median age of 33.7 years. 31.04 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 17.56 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 34.75 percent of the residents in 73645 is currently married, and 13.70 percent of the population has never been married.

The monthly median household income in 73645 is $6,062.50.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 73645 is approximately $659. The median household spends about 10.87 percent of their income on housing.

Brief History and Local Culture
Erick has a rich history rooted in its early days as a railroad town. The town's growth was closely tied to the development of the railroad system in the late 19th century, which brought economic opportunities and settlers to the area. Today, Erick maintains its small-town charm while embracing its historical legacy through local museums and cultural events.
